"""
#### Synopsis
Script to get the details of groups managed by OM Enterprise
#### Description
This script uses the OME REST API to get a group and the
device details for all devices in that group. For authentication
X-Auth is used over Basic Authentication
Note that the credentials entered are not stored to disk.
#### Python Example
`python get_group_details.py --ip <xx> --user <username> --password <pwd>
--groupinfo "All Devices"`
"""
import argparse
import json
import sys
from argparse import RawTextHelpFormatter
from getpass import getpass
import requests
import urllib3
def get_group_details(ip_address, user_name, password, group_info):
""" List out group details based on id/name/description """
try:
base_uri = 'https://%s' % ip_address
session_url = base_uri + '/api/SessionService/Sessions'
group_url = base_uri + '/api/GroupService/Groups'
next_link_url = None
headers = {'content-type': 'application/json'}
user_details = {'UserName': user_name,
'Password': password,
'SessionType': 'API'}
session_info = requests.post(session_url, verify=False,
data=json.dumps(user_details),
headers=headers)
if session_info.status_code == 201:
headers['X-Auth-Token'] = session_info.headers['X-Auth-Token']
response = requests.get(group_url, headers=headers, verify=False)
if response.status_code == 200:
group_list = response.json()
group_count = group_list['@odata.count']
if group_count > 0:
found_group = False
if '@odata.nextLink' in group_list:
next_link_url = base_uri + group_list['@odata.nextLink']
while next_link_url:
next_link_response = requests.get(next_link_url, headers=headers, verify=False)
if next_link_response.status_code == 200:
next_link_json_data = next_link_response.json()
group_list['value'] += next_link_json_data['value']
if '@odata.nextLink' in next_link_json_data:
next_link_url = base_uri + next_link_json_data['@odata.nextLink']
else:
next_link_url = None
else:
print("Unable to get full group list ... ")
next_link_url = None
for group in group_list['value']:
if ((str(group['Id']).lower() == group_info.lower()) or
str(group['Name']).lower() == group_info.lower() or
str(group['Description']).lower() ==
group_info.lower()):
found_group = True
print("*** Group Details ***")
print(json.dumps(group, indent=4, sort_keys=True))
dev_url = group_url + "(" + str(group['Id']) + ")/Devices"
dev_response = requests.get(dev_url,
headers=headers,
verify=False)
if dev_response.status_code == 200:
device_list = dev_response.json()
device_count = device_list['@odata.count']
if device_count > 0:
if '@odata.nextLink' in device_list:
next_link_url = base_uri + device_list['@odata.nextLink']
while next_link_url:
next_link_response = requests.get(next_link_url, headers=headers, verify=False)
if next_link_response.status_code == 200:
next_link_json_data = next_link_response.json()
device_list['value'] += next_link_json_data['value']
if '@odata.nextLink' in next_link_json_data:
next_link_url = base_uri + next_link_json_data['@odata.nextLink']
else:
next_link_url = None
else:
print("Unable to get full device list ... ")
next_link_url = None
print("\n*** Group Device Details ***")
print(json.dumps(device_list, indent=4,
sort_keys=True))
else:
print("Unable to get devices for (%s)" % group_info)
break
if not found_group:
print("No group matching (%s) found" % group_info)
else:
print("No group data retrieved from %s" % ip_address)
else:
print("Unable to retrieve group list from %s" % ip_address)
else:
print("Unable to create a session with appliance %s" % ip_address)
except Exception as error:
print("Unexpected error:", str(error))
if __name__ == '__main__':
urllib3.disable_warnings(urllib3.exceptions.InsecureRequestWarning)
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description=__doc__, formatter_class=RawTextHelpFormatter)
parser.add_argument("--ip", "-i", required=True, help="OME Appliance IP")
parser.add_argument("--user", "-u", required=True,
help="Username for OME Appliance",
default="admin")
parser.add_argument("--password", "-p", required=False,
help="Password for OME Appliance")
parser.add_argument("--groupinfo", "-g", required=True,
help="Group id/Name/Description - case insensitive")
args = parser.parse_args()
if not args.password:
if not sys.stdin.isatty():
# notify user that they have a bad terminal
# perhaps if os.name == 'nt': , prompt them to use winpty?
print("Your terminal is not compatible with Python's getpass module. You will need to provide the"
" --password argument instead. See https://stackoverflow.com/a/58277159/4427375")
sys.exit(0)
else:
password = getpass()
else:
password = args.password
get_group_details(args.ip, args.user, password, str(args.groupinfo))
